NASHVILLE, Tenn., April 20, 2017 -- Truxton Corporation (OTCPK:TRUX), a financial holding company and the parent of Truxton Trust Company (the “Bank”), reported consolidated net income of $1,459,763 for the first quarter of 2017, a 30 percent increase compared with $1,122,320 for the first quarter of 2016. Earnings per fully diluted share for the quarter ended March 31, 2017 totaled $0.54 versus $0.42 for the same period in 2016.
At March 31, 2017, the company reported total assets of $431.4 million, a 5 percent increase from March 31, 2016. Over the same period, total loans increased 11 percent to $289.7 million, while deposits grew 4 percent to $361.6 million. At March 31, 2017, the Bank’s estimated Tier 1 leverage ratio was 10.80 percent.
Non-interest income for the first quarter of 2017 was $2,257,000, compared to $1,937,000 for the same period in 2016, an increase of 16 percent.
Tangible Book Value per share at March 31, 2017 was $17.84 compared to $16.69 at the same time a year ago.
“We’ve begun 2017 very strongly, growing our EPS 29% compared to a year ago,” said CEO Tom Stumb. He continued, “We have experienced excellent loan growth in the past year. Wealth Management revenue grew by 17% compared to the March quarter of 2016. We controlled expenses tightly and delivered improved margins.”
